The Importance of Financial Planning 101: Setting Yourself Up for Financial Success

Financial planning is crucial for achieving your financial goals and making your dreams a reality. You need to have a clear picture of your current financial situation, your short-term and long-term goals, and the steps you need to take to achieve them. This involves creating a comprehensive financial plan that takes into account your income, expenses, savings, investments, debts, and other assets.

Here’s why financial planning is so important:

1. It Helps You to Achieve Your Financial Goals

Financial planning is all about setting clear, realistic, and achievable financial goals that align with your life goals. Whether you want to buy a house, start a business, save for your children’s education, or retire comfortably, financial planning can help you achieve your goals. By setting spec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als, you can track your progress and take corrective action if needed.

2. It Enhances Financial Understanding and Awareness

Financial planning helps you to understand your financial situation better and make informed decisions based on data and analysis. You will be able to identify potential risks, opportunities, and gaps in your financial plan and take proactive steps to address them. You will also have greater awareness and control over your finances, which can reduce stress and improve your overall well-being.

3. It Helps to Manage Your Finances Efficiently

Financial planning enables you to manage your money more efficiently by prioritizing your expenses, optimizing your savings, and investing intelligently. You can minimize your expenses, increase your income, reduce your debts, and build your wealth over time. With a sound financial plan, you will be able to make informed decisions about your investments, retirement planning, and tax strategies.

4. It Helps to Mitigate Financial Risks

Financial planning helps you to identify potential financial risks and take appropriate measures to manage them. For example, you may need to consider insurance products such as life insurance, health insurance, and disability insurance to protect yourself and your family against unforeseen events. You may also need to create an emergency fund to cover unexpected expenses or loss of income.
